Epstein Files Embroil Norwegian Diplomats and Politicians, Raising Questions About Oslo Accords

Oslo – A widening scandal stemming from the release of Jeffrey Epstein’s flight logs and correspondence is shaking Norway’s political establishment, implicating former prime ministers, high-ranking diplomats, and even the current head of the World Economic Forum’s Norway chapter. The revelations are not only causing a crisis of confidence in key figures but too raising concerns about potential compromises to the historic 1993 Oslo Accords.

Crown Princess Mette-Marit and High-Profile Figures Linked to Epstein

The recent release of emails and letters by the US Department of Justice has brought to light previously undisclosed connections between numerous Norwegians and the convicted sex offender. Crown Princess Mette-Marit has admitted to being “embarrassed” by her correspondence with Epstein, which spanned from 2011 to 2014 and revealed a closer relationship than she had previously acknowledged. Reports indicate she even traveled to Epstein’s home in Palm Beach, Florida, for “meditation” sessions, sometimes leaving her family to do so. As of February 3, 2026, 76 percent of Norwegians had lost confidence in the Crown Princess, according to reports.

Diplomatic Fallout: Rød-Larsen, Juul, and Allegations of Corruption

The scandal extends beyond the royal family, ensnaring prominent diplomats Terje Rød-Larsen and Mona Juul. Rød-Larsen, a key architect of the Oslo Accords, is facing allegations of corruption, illicit loans, and visa fraud related to sex-trafficked women. Newly released documents reveal he was deeply embedded in Epstein’s inner circle and even had a beneficiary clause in Epstein’s will worth millions of dollars.

Juul, who served as Norway’s ambassador to Jordan and Iraq, resigned from her post this month after her security clearance was revoked. Both Juul and Rød-Larsen are currently under investigation by Norway’s financial crimes squad, Økokrim, on suspicion of gross corruption. Økokrim is investigating whether Juul received benefits in connection with her position at the foreign affairs ministry. Rød-Larsen has apologized for his relationship with Epstein and stepped down as chief executive of the International Peace Institute (IPI) in 2020.

Oslo Accords Under Scrutiny

The revelations surrounding Rød-Larsen’s ties to Epstein have sparked fears that the Oslo Accords, a landmark agreement in the Israeli-Palestinian peace process, may have been compromised. Palestinian leaders are now questioning whether the agreements were brokered by a mediator vulnerable to blackmail and foreign intelligence pressure.

Støre’s Response and Concerns Over Document Access

Prime Minister Jonas Gahr Støre has expressed concern over the revelations, particularly regarding the involvement of his former colleagues Rød-Larsen and Juul. However, a former national archivist has accused Støre of halting the hunt for secret documents related to Rød-Larsen, raising further questions about transparency and accountability. Støre has denied these accusations.
